8412 W Mount Morris Rd, Flushing, Michigan 48433
The Pine Tree Barn is a rustic wedding venue located in East Central Michigan and gives you 20 acres of private space to celebrate. The barn is able to hold up to 200 guests and will let you choose your own catering. The vibes here are immaculate, mixing rustic wooden ceilings with crystal chandeliers for a perfectly dreamy space!
15009 Holly Hills Dr, Holly, Michigan 48442
Originally the processing center of an apple orchard, The Grand Belle is an authentic barn that has been modernized for your dream day. The venue is able to host up to 160 guests and offers both indoor and outdoor spaces. The cellar is especially great for a cocktail hour!

6199 North Ridge Road, New Lothrop, Michigan 48460
The Barn on the Ridge is an East Central Michigan spot that is able to host up to 350 guests, making it the ideal spot for larger weddings. This space is surrounded by lush countryside, complete with a rushing waterfall. The barn itself was constructed in 2017, giving you rustic vibes with completely modern amenities.
8683 Birch Run Road, Millington, Michigan 48746
If you want a spot that feels as though it’s fresh from the pages of a storybook, Odins Owl is for you! Nestled on 80 acres, this space takes inspiration from the Anglo-Saxon era, offering a Mead Hall complete with wooden cathedral ceilings and intricately carved chandeliers. The magical forests just outside the doors are perfect for woodsy ceremonies!

8235 New Lothrop Road, New Lothrop, Michigan 48460
Rustic Meadows is tucked away into the quiet town of New Lothrop and is a Michigan venue ready to hold up to 220 wedding guests. While I know you are going to adore their rustic barn, they offer unique spots you won’t find anywhere else. Your guests can grab drinks in the on-site silo bar or cozy up in the evening around the outdoor firepit. They also offer an on-site AirBnB.

2224 S Canal St, Eaton Rapids, Michigan 48827
If you need the ideal spot for smaller weddings, I think you might love Willow Wood Farm! This location is able to hold up to 150 guests and offers both indoor and outdoor spaces. The surrounding countryside out here is what makes this spot such a favorite! With wooden fences and lush farmland, your ceremony is going to be one to remember!
6484 Sutton Road, Whitmore Lake, Michigan 48189
Sutton Barn combines farmhouse vibes with country club luxury to ensure your wedding day is absolutely seamless. Across the 165 acres, you are going to have no shortage of backdrops, including a small lake, verdant willow trees, and stone pathways. The venue can hold up to 200 guests.

3116 E. Vienna Rd, Clio, Michigan 48420
Celestial Farms is a nature-filled venue located on 20 private acres outside of Detroit. The climate-controlled barn is going to give you wedding options for every season, giving you rustic backdrops without the typical farmhouse inconveniences. They can hold up to 150 guests and will provide you with a team ready to give you your dream day.
2605 S Old US Hwy 23, Brighton, Michigan 48114
Tandale Nature Barn is located in Livingston County and can accommodate up to 220 guests. The barn here is huge, giving you up to 5,400 square feet for your celebration. You are going to have no shortage of spots for your party, including an open-air cathedral, a pond overlook, and a massive treehouse!

7650 Scio Church Rd, Ann Arbor, Michigan 48103
Frutig Farms is a spot with no shortage of charm! This working farm gives you acres of lush exteriors, adorable animals, and a fully restored wedding barn. The venue is able to hold up to 250 guests and offers an event tent ideal for outdoor receptions. They are also going to give you plenty of options for catering.

4900 32 Miles Road, Washington, Michigan 48095
If you need a spot for parties of all sizes, you are going to love Crimson Hills! Located near Rochester, this venue offers enough space for up to 500 guests. For your ceremony, you will have the rolling apple orchards as your backdrop. The reception hall is outfitted with barn wood and large windows that show off the surrounding property.
